Richard E. Engles Resume

Picture of Richard E. Engles Rick Engles began his career in aviation as a supervisor for American Airlines at John F. Kennedy International Airport from 1966 through 1969.

Upon leaving American Airlines he became Manager of Charter Sales for Pan American World Airways' Business Jet Division based in New York between 1970 and 1972.

In 1973 Mr. Engles became an investor in -- and the Vice President of Sales for Executive Jet Aviation of Columbus, Ohio. At that time EJA was the world's largest owner and operator of business jet aircraft.

From 1976 to 1993 he worked for British Aerospace's Corporate Jet Division. During the six-year period between 1987 and 1993, Rick was the North American Sales Director being responsible for the sale of 124 new aircraft representing a total value of 1.2 billion dollars.

Following the purchase of BAe's Corporate Jet Division by the Raytheon Corporation in August 1993, Mr. Engles and Jim Vance formed Vance & Engles Aircraft Brokers, Inc. Mr. Engles is the president of that company.
